A key component of the new Ritchey WCS Switch System, the WCS Switch Upper Headset upper is designed to specifically work with the Ritchey Switch Stem to route cables, wires and hydraulic lines from the handlebar through to the bicycle frame. Cables are routed from the handlebar into the headset conduit, which sits on the underside of the Switch Stem and then travel through an opening on the front of the WCS Switch headset spacers before passing through two channels on the top of the headset and into the frame. This system allows headset bearings to perform without any interference from cables, wires, or lines passing through the headtube. Wolf Tooth English (BSA) bottom brackets are engineered to be durable, reliable, lightweight, and smooth. The weather sealing is best-in-class, with o-ring seals on the spindle and inner shell, a wiper connection seal between the bearing and end cap, bearing race seals, and a labyrinth end cap design. To prevent creaking, spindle bushings separate the bearing inner race and crank spindle to eliminate metal-on-metal contact. The custom chrome bearings has been hardened for improved durability and reduced friction with ZNA corrosion-resistant coating, while the ball diameter, width, and counts were custom selected by Wolf Tooth for top quality based on spindle diameter. Wolf Tooth bottom brackets are machined at Wolf Tooth in Minnesota, USA. Wolf Tooth T47 Internal bottom Brackets are engineered to be smooth, durable, lightweight, fast, and user-serviceable. Their ground-up design features custom bearings, seals, bushings, and cups, which eliminate creaking and balance best-in-class weather sealing with optimized bearing radial compression, alignment, and preload for low drag. The Wolf Tooth Bottom Bracket bearings feature custom designed balls and races that are made from a hardened chrome bearing steel which has a higher surface hardness than stainless to improve the durability, reduce spinning resistance, and noise. An ACOSUR ZNA coating has also been applied to the race to provide corrosion resistance that is equal to or better than stainless steel after a 500-hour saltwater test. Bearing material paired with an extensive sealing system and the elimination of metal-on-metal contact means Wolf Tooth Bottom Brackets deliver superior performance in all conditions. Wolf Tooth bottom brackets are designed, engineered, machined and assembled in-house at Wolf Tooth HQ in Minnesota, USA. The Resolute is the ultimate all-weather gravel tire for those who don't want to fuss with conditions-specific tires for every season. Small, square knobs deliver consistent bite into a variety of terrain, while the ample spaces between them prevent packing up when conditions become fun (a.k.a wet). Truly all-season in nature, the Resolute's width makes it a set-it-andforget-it gravel tire for endlessly undulating roads through all varieties of weather. Druid V2 Frame Layout The second iteration of Druid see a shift to an inverted four-bar suspension design. This evolution was necessitated by our desire to retain the ride characteristics of the original Druid while achieving certain design goals. At the same time, we shed a little bit of weight from the main frame, whilst ensuring the bike still passes our rigorous testing regime. Hardware The bearing-in-rocker design of our new forged V2 Rate Control Linkage allows us to use locking collet axles and oversized bearings for easy maintenance and dependability. This option isn’t the lightest but trading a few grams for a long-lasting, easily serviced linkage, was the practical choice. Idler Pulley System Druid now sports an 18-tooth steel idler equipped with a solid lube bearing as standard. These changes, along with a refined tooth profile increase the idler’s longevity and ensure compatibility with the latest drivetrains. Our new idler, along with its modular mounting system is compatible and optimized for use with both 52mm and 55mm chain lines.
